Self-charging
A well-designed vacuum cleaner will make your house clean and tidy with no effort from you. It takes care of everything and you have to give it a few instructions on how to complete the task. It will also charge itself if its battery is low, which makes it a great solution for busy households. Certain smart vacuums that self-charge can be controlled remotely through an app for smartphones or via voice commands with smart speakers, such as Amazon Echo and Google Assistant.
Some self-charging robot cleaner s may get stuck under furniture that is low or thresholds, or tangled in clothing, cords, shoelaces and pet toys. This will stop their cleaning routine. Choose a model that has a well-trained object detection technology. This will enable it to detect common obstacles like cords and toys. Some models are capable of navigating through open doors, which can save you time and effort while cleaning.

Self-docking
A self-docking smart vacuum cleaner is a groundbreaking piece of machinery that offers the ultimate in convenience. It automatically returns to its dock when its battery is empty or it has finished cleaning and reloads itself to begin where it began. This technology is ideal for busy homeowners who need an always clean home without having to lift a hand. Apart from self-docking, these robots also boast impressive mapping and navigation capabilities. These robotic vacuum cleaners have sensors and motors that are designed to navigate in tight spaces. They also have the ability to reach difficult-to-reach areas, such as under furniture and nooks and crannys.
Another benefit of this device is its capability to monitor and adjust cleaning settings remotely. The smart vacuum cleaner uses Wi-Fi to connect with a home's network, and then sync with a smartphone or tablet which allows owners to monitor and control their device from anywhere in the world. It features a simple and simple interface that makes it easy to use. It can even be programmed to vacuum and wipe floors at certain times.

When choosing the best smart vacuum cleaner, you should be aware your data may be shared with third-party companies especially if you are connected to an WiFi network. Check out the privacy policies of the manufacturer and choose one that prioritizes privacy of the user. This will safeguard your privacy and keep you from receiving unwanted messages or advertisements.
